Solid lifter slants, have splash oiling on the lifter base, and just, for lack of a better word, drip oiling of the lifter bore.
Hydraulic lifter slants, have the lifters lubed, through hollow pushrods, rocker arms, and rocker shaft.
A FYI: the rocker arms, rocker shaft, push rods, and lifters are different between the two versions. As, of course, is the cam.
